Existing law prescribes requirements for the disposal of surplus land by a local agency. Existing law reaffirms the Legislatures declaration that surplus land, prior to disposition, should be made available for housing for persons and families of low and moderate income, and reaffirms the Legislatures declaration of the importance of appropriate planning and development near transit stations to encourage the clustering of housing and commercial development around those stations.
This bill would revise those declarations related to transit stations to, instead, reaffirm the Legislatures declaration of the importance of appropriate planning and development near transit stops to encourage the clustering of housing and commercial development around those stops.
